With several hundred homes and cabins burned up in the #2025wildfires, insurance is a big deal.
"SGI Canada alone has received over 1,300 wildfire related claims so far. Of those, about 750 were for home and property while more than 560 were auto claims."

The price of chanterelles may be heading up.
Not a lot of people understand how much people pick mushrooms in SK as a form of income. This is a big loss for La Ronge, in addition to the burning of the Robertson's Trading Post, a community landmark in this year's wildfires.

17 deaths in Birch Narrows (pop. 800) in the last 3 months. 3 were natural.

"Our community cannot withstand this continuing cycle of loss and grief without substantive intervention" Chief Johnathan Sylvestre of Birch Narrows FN.
